What Are MEP Estimating Services?
MEP estimating services are the process of quantifying, costing, and forecasting the full scope of Mechanical, Electrical, and Plumbing systems within a building. These systems must be integrated seamlessly to ensure that the entire structure functions as intended. Professional estimators evaluate construction documents, plans, and specifications to provide reliable cost assessments, including:
-
Ductwork systems for air distribution
-
Chilled and hot water piping for heating and cooling
-
Electrical raceways, panels, and fixtures
-
Plumbing supply, drain, and vent systems
-
Fire protection, gas, and specialty piping
-
Building automation and controls
Estimators must also understand project phasing, local labor rates, energy codes, equipment lead times, and value engineering strategies. This high-level coordination across trades makes MEP estimating services a vital part of modern construction success.
What Do Mechanical Estimating Services Include?
While MEP covers a broader scope, mechanical estimating services focus on the HVAC and piping systemsarguably the most technically demanding of the three trades. These services break down the mechanical portion of a project into manageable, cost-specific components such as:
-
Heating & Cooling Equipment Rooftop units, chillers, boilers, air handlers, heat pumps
-
Ductwork & Insulation Type, gauge, insulation type, and layout complexities
-
Piping Systems Chilled water, hot water, condenser water, steam, and refrigerant lines
-
Ventilation Systems Exhaust fans, kitchen hoods, and fresh air intakes
-
Controls and Automation Thermostats, sensors, variable-speed controls, and integration with BAS
This granular level of detail enables clients to understand exactly whats being priced, why it costs what it does, and how design decisions impact the overall budget.
Our Estimating Workflow
Weve designed a robust estimating process that supports both MEP estimating services and mechanical estimating services:
1. Project Review
We assess drawings, specs, addenda, and RFI responses to develop a deep understanding of the projects scope and intent.
2. Digital Takeoffs
Our team uses software such as Trimble Accubid, QuoteSoft, PlanSwift, and Bluebeam to produce highly accurate quantity takeoffs. These include:
-
Linear feet of pipe
-
CFM and square feet of duct
-
Fixture and equipment counts
-
Device and control point takeoffs
-
Fitting, hanger, and valve quantities
3. Labor Mapping
We apply union or non-union productivity rates depending on location, project height, access difficulty, and other jobsite variables.
4. Material Pricing
Estimates are populated with current prices from national and regional suppliers, factoring in taxes, shipping, and escalation.
5. Proposal Generation
You receive a fully formatted Excel or PDF estimate, ready to be submitted with your bid or used internally for budgeting, scheduling, and procurement.
